## Authentication

Bouncebox authenticates to the internal suppression-list service with a single static key passed in the `X-Bouncebox-Auth` header. Yes, it's a bit old-school — rotation is manual and happens quarterly, which is probably the first thing you'll flag in review. TLS is enforced end to end and the key is scoped read-write to suppression entries only. The current key in use is shown here.

API key for yahig-tadup: kto7_ubizbYm

## Authentication

Gravelport enforces per-tenant rate quotas at the gateway. Each tenant gets 500 req/min by default; overages return 429. Quotas are keyed off the auth token, not the IP, so don't share tokens across tenants. For the sync demo, hit the quota-admin service with the shared eng key, which is:

API key for tajop-tagaf: zpat15_wFKIn9d85K88goH

## Partner SFTP Drop — Overview (Harwick Feeds)

Welcome aboard! Partners upload nightly flat files to the Brindle drop zone, and our poller sweeps them into the ingest pipeline. Files land in per-partner folders; we never write back into their directories. Poll frequency, file-size ceilings, and stale-file cutoffs are all configurable and occasionally argued about. The current tuning constants are listed below.

tuning table, kageg-yaduf:
PRIORITIES = {
    "gilmir": 701,
    "druiel": 604,
}